About Barangay Allinguigan 1st
Classified as a small barangay, Barangay Allinguigan 1st is one of the administrative divisions of City of Ilagan in Isabela, Cagayan Valley, Philippines.
According to the 2020 Census of Population and Housing conducted by the Philippine Statistics Authority, Barangay Allinguigan 1st had a population of 1,909. This made it the 25th largest of 91 barangays in City of Ilagan by population, placing it in the upper half of the city. Residents of Barangay Allinguigan 1st accounted for approximately 1.21% of the total population of City of Ilagan, which stood at 158,218 in the same census year.
The barangay recorded 1,896 residents in the 2015 intercensal count and 1,909 residents in the 2020 Census — a net change of +0.7%, consistent with a slowly expanding settlement. The Philippine Statistics Authority classifies Barangay Allinguigan 1st as rural, a designation applied to barangays with lower population density and predominantly non-built-up land use.
City of Ilagan is a city comprising 91 barangays, and serves as the governing unit directly responsible for local services in Barangay Allinguigan 1st, including public health, sanitation, peace and order, and civil registration. Within the wider province of Isabela, which contains 1,055 barangays across its component cities and municipalities, Barangay Allinguigan 1st ranks 289th by 2020 population. Isabela is classified as a 1st by the Bureau of Local Government Finance, a category that reflects the province's annual regular income.
Like every Philippine barangay, Barangay Allinguigan 1st is led by an elected Punong Barangay (barangay captain) supported by seven Sangguniang Barangay members (kagawads), an SK Chairperson, a Barangay Secretary, and a Barangay Treasurer. The next Barangay and Sangguniang Kabataan Elections (BSKE) are scheduled for Monday, November 2, 2026, with officials serving four-year terms under Republic Act No. 12232.
